dilate

THRO’OUT the Whole, we have had a particular regard, both in the Choice of the feveral heads, and in dwelling or amplifying upon ’em ; to the extending our Views, dilating our Knowledge, opening new Tracks, new scents, new Viftas. We have endeavour’d not only to furnifh the Mind ; but to inlarge it, and make it in fome meafure co-extend with the Dimenfions of all minds, in all Ages and Places, and under all Situations and Circumftances : as Language, in fome meafure, makes our Senfes do. With which view, we have given the Sentiments, Notions, Manners, Cuftoms, &c. of moft People, that have anything new, unufual, or hardy in ’em.

Chambers Cyclopaedia, 1728 preface
